Transaction 74a39e9581a6ccfe64d7a8b384c571bfdca8647a0173cc986404bdb2c2709e14
1 Input
1 Output
-
74a39e9581a6ccfe64d7a8b384c571bfdca8647a0173cc986404bdb2c2709e14:0
- value
- 13180672
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fb6e1cca3b5cf4cf77f257f16f2b087caf1c7c3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KwHxaMP8uvhqz38Zp5pB9uCmH4xRoTkzz